Hamilton: Known for hitting prowess Indian batsman Rohit Sharma is set to play his 200thODI when they take on New Zealand during the fourth ODI here on Thursday to become the 15th Indian player.     
  
Rohit began his ODI career on June 23, 2007 at Belfast in Ireland. After 12 years the stand-in-captain will complete his 200th ODI. Rohit is the only player to score three consecutive double centuries in the ODIs. From 199 matches he has amassed 7799 runs with 22 centuries and 39 half-centuries at an average of 48.14.  
 
Other Indian players who have completed this feat are Sachin Tendulkar (463), M S Dhoni (337),  Mohammad Azharuddin (334), Sourav Ganguly (311), Yuvraj Singh (304), Yuvraj Singh (304), Anil Kumble (271), Virender Sehwag (251), Harbhajan Singh (236), Javagal Srinath (229), Suresh Raina (226), Kapil Dev (225), Virat Kohli (222) and Zaheer Khan (200).  (UNI)
